Overview

The ADA4177-4ARZ-RL is a quad-channel precision operational amplifier from Analog Devices, featuring integrated overvoltage protection and EMI filtering. It operates on dual supplies ranging from ±2.5 V to ±18 V with a maximum supply voltage of 36 V. Key electrical parameters include a maximum input offset voltage of 60 µV at 25°C, a maximum drift of 1 µV/°C, and a typical supply current of 500 µA per amplifier. The device offers a gain bandwidth product of 3.5 MHz, a slew rate of 1.5 V/µs, and rail-to-rail output swing. Inputs are protected up to 32 V beyond the supply rails, providing robust performance in harsh environments.

Feature Summary

  • Integrated electromagnetic interference (EMI) filter provides high rejection at 1000 MHz and 2400 MHz.
  • Input overvoltage protection allows signal excursions up to 32 V beyond either supply rail without damage.
  • Rail-to-rail output capability ensures maximum dynamic range across the full operating temperature range.
  • Unity-gain stable design eliminates the need for external compensation when driving capacitive loads exceeding 1000 pF.

Applications

  • Wireless base station control circuits
  • Optical network control circuits
  • Sensor signal conditioning for thermocouples, RTDs, and strain gages
  • Process control front-end amplifiers

Selection Notes

Select this component for applications requiring high precision combined with robust input protection against extreme voltage transients. The low noise density and low bias current make it suitable for high-impedance sensor interfaces. Consider the thermal resistance characteristics of the 14-lead SOIC package when designing for high ambient temperatures or heavy load conditions.

Part Context

This part belongs to the ADA4177 family of precision amplifiers, which includes single (ADA4177-1), dual (ADA4177-2), and quad (ADA4177-4) channel variants. The family is characterized by its combination of low offset voltage, low power consumption, and advanced input protection features. It serves as an evolution in protected input op-amps, integrating EMI filtering capabilities not found in earlier generations like the OP191 or ADA4091 series.

Replacement Considerations

Direct pin-compatible replacements within the same family include the ADA4177-1ARZ and ADA4177-2ARZ for reduced channel counts. For legacy systems, the OP4177ARZ offers similar precision but lacks the integrated overvoltage and EMI protection features. Verify functional equivalence regarding input protection limits and bandwidth requirements when substituting.
